Analysis

IDA & IBRD total recorded 0.5303 current US$ per US$ of GDP for households and npishs final consumption expenditure (current us$) in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.7% on the previous year and up 1.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, households and npishs final consumption expenditure (current us$) in IDA & IBRD total peaked at 0.6984 current US$ per US$ of GDP in 1962 and was at its lowest, 0.5045 current US$ per US$ of GDP, in 2022.

That places IDA & IBRD total 33rd out of 43 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 65 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Households and NPISHs Final consumption expenditure (current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Households and NPISHs Final consumption expenditure (current US$) ÷ GDP (current US$)
